Last season the Lions agreed to an exchange that would send the Eagles two second-day draft picks for Samuel but the deal fall apart in the final stages, the Eagles are now trading Samuel to the Falcons for a late round pick.

The two big problems with Samuel this season is that he is now 31 years old and he's owed a $9.4 million base salary which means he needs to re-do his deal.

Yes, and it does. We really thought this off season would be a big one seeing as we don't have mayn picks so we'd be much more free agent friendly. We signed a G who will likely start at RG in Manuwai who is solid might I add. Also a MLB in Tatupu who will mentor and compete for the starting job against Akeem Dent. And we re-signed most of our FA. We also lost VanGorder and got Nolan, who is a very good DC. His system is favorable to the defensive backs so I think that definitely had something to do with Grimes signing and getting Samuel
